Yesterday - FOE! I went to give a presentation to the Richmond Multimedia User's Group at VCU, and was hit with a slew of unexpected technical snafus. First, I wasn't able to get on the wireless without rebooting - odd, I'm a mac user. Next came the fatal blow - I couldn't connect to our campus server using our VPN software! Yikes! In order to use Contribute Publishing Services, Dreamweaver, and Contribute together, you must use the Internet. So, as any instructor knows when teaching, it is always necessary to have a back up plan. Instead of showing off Contribute Publishing Services, I doubled back and showed Breeze. The other presenter was John from Leadmine Pond. He showed us some interesting Flash components that he uses over and over. [Nb: Work smarter, not harder.] He also gave us a good link - gmodeler.com It is a website that allows you to stub out Actionscript code. Other links to remember [made by Chris from RMUG:
